Hiya,
I'm using Magazine theme in a WP 3.6.1, but I don't understand how to use "most popular" and "what's hot" widgets with GK News Show, wich includes this theme.
I've installed quickstart version:
- Most popular is showing "latest post" with offset 0. Not most hitted posts or most rated or something similar.
- What's hot is showing "latest post" with offset 5. So if i put offset to 0 they show the same.
Is this correct?
I'd like to show most visited post on "Most popular". Can I use some widget to do it?
Thanks in advance.

To be honest, those are just "buzz" words to name the elements. WP don't have any build in mechanism for counting posts/pages visits, so there is no way to sort elements by visit count.
